1. Introduzione
The AVerMedia Live Gamer HD 2 (GC570) is an internal PCIe game capture card designed for recording and streaming high-definition gameplay. It supports Full HD 1080p at 60 frames per second, offering a low-latency HDMI pass-through experience. This device is compatible with various gaming platforms including Xbox, PlayStation, Nintendo Switch, and PC, and operates seamlessly with Windows 11, 10, 8.1 (UVC Protocol), and Windows 7 (driver installation required).
The Live Gamer HD 2 is engineered for ease of use, featuring plug-and-play functionality for most modern Windows operating systems, eliminating the need for complex driver installations. It provides both uncompressed video output for superior picture quality and compressed video output for lower bandwidth requirements, supporting multi-card setups for advanced streaming configurations.

3. Caratteristiche del prodotto
3.1. High-Quality Capture and Pass-Through
The Live Gamer HD 2 captures and records Full HD 1080p60 gameplay with uncompressed video output, ensuring exceptional picture quality. Its low-latency HDMI pass-through allows for simultaneous streaming and playing without noticeable delay.

3.2. Plug and Play with Multi-Card Support
This capture card offers plug-and-play support for Windows 11, 10, and 8.1, requiring no driver installation. It also supports multi-card setups, allowing up to 4 cards on your gaming PC to capture different sources simultaneously (multi-card support software is required).

3.3. Flexible Audio Connections
The Live Gamer HD 2 provides flexible audio options, including digital HDMI and analog 3.5mm ports. This allows you to record audio from consoles, PCs, or output to mixers for advanced audio mixing.

4. Configurazione e installazione
4.1. Installazione fisica
- Spegnere il computer e scollegare tutti i cavi.
- Apri il case del computer.
- Individua uno slot PCIe x1 disponibile sulla scheda madre.
- Carefully insert the Live Gamer HD 2 into the PCIe slot until it is firmly seated.
- Secure the card with a screw to the computer chassis.
- Chiudi il case del computer e ricollega tutti i cavi.

4.2. Collegamento dei dispositivi
Connect your gaming console or PC's HDMI output to the Ingresso HDMI port on the Live Gamer HD 2. Connect your display (monitor/TV) to the Uscita HDMI port on the Live Gamer HD 2. For audio, use the 3.5mm Audio In/Out ports as needed for external audio sources or monitoring.

7. Risoluzione Dei Problemi
7.1. No Signal Detected
- Assicurarsi che tutti i cavi HDMI siano collegati saldamente alle porte di ingresso/uscita corrette.
- Verify that your gaming console or PC is powered on and outputting video.
- Check your display settings on the source device to ensure it's outputting a compatible resolution (1080p60 max).
- Restart RECentral 4 or your computer.
7.2. Nessun audio
- Confirm that the 3.5mm audio cable is connected if you are using analog audio input.
- Check audio settings within RECentral 4 to ensure the correct audio source is selected.
- Verify system audio settings on your PC and source device.
7.3. Performance Issues (Lag/Stuttering)
- Ensure your PC meets the minimum system requirements for RECentral 4 and streaming/recording.
- Chiudere le applicazioni in background non necessarie per liberare risorse di sistema.
- Aggiorna i driver della tua scheda grafica alla versione più recente.
- If using compressed video output, try adjusting the bitrate or quality settings in RECentral 4.
